ALC back on track, confirms new owner

New owner of Apple Languages, Jos van Kerkhof of StudyTravel, has confirmed that with the support of the study travel sector, he is steering the UK-based outbound study agency which he acquired last year towards recovering business vitality.

Van Kerkhof, a veteran of 20 years in the sector, acquired the agency late last year after major debts threatened LCA (actual company name) and called into question financial arrangements that it had with its language school partners in terms of payment protocol.

Van Kerkhof told The PIE News that he had noticed higher expectations from schools in general regarding payment procedures since the predicament – major debts engulfing the former owner – became known in late 2012.

A new company, Apple Language Courses (ALC) was set up this year by Van Kerkhof, which alongside the old company that he acquired, LCA, is working with web domains that include www.applelanguages.com and also www.languagesabroad.co.uk.

“We pay all schools in advance,” underlined Van Kerkhof, who runs another successful study abroad operator StudyTravel, noting that the priority since the takeover had been to run “business as usual” with all the same partner schools.

He aims to repay some of the sizable debts owed from future profits once the administrator completes its oversight of LCA. His company also ensured all LCA’s clients studying at the time of the crisis were bailed out and able to complete their courses.

“The company is definitely benefiting from improvements to efficiency that we are able to make given our strong 20-year track record of running an outbound study travel agency,” van Kerkhof said, noting that a centralised web-based booking system has been ushered in, for example.

“I’m grateful for the support of the sector and in particular, [membership organisation] IALC for backing this resolution,” he added. ALC is UK-based but clients from the rest of Europe and North America represent 60% of its client base.
